Banga Soup

Banga soup is another name of Palm Nut Soup, an African soup made by extracting the liquid out of a palm fruit. It is widely eaten all over West Africa to the Cameroon and is traditionally made by boiling about 100-200 palm fruits in a pot of water for about 20 minutes until the pulp softens. Banga soup is a soup made from the sauce squeezed from palm fruit (Elaeis guineensis) which is widely eaten all over West Africa to the Cameroon.

Banh can

Banh can refers to a Vietnamese dish made from rice and yellow mung bean. The cake is filled with shrimp and scallions.

Bánh Chu?i / Banh Chuoi

Bánh Chu?i is a Vietnamese term which literally means "Banana Cake". Bánh Chu?i sweet Banana Cake or a banana bread pudding made basically of ripe banana as the main ingredient. Aside from ripe bananas or plantains, Bánh Chu?i is made from varieties of ingredients, like coconut milk, sugar, white bread, shredded young coconut, etc., although its exact ingredient may vary according taste and to the available ingredient.
